The Global Zero Turn Mower Market continues to experience robust growth, with market valuation estimated at $3.8 billion in 2024 and projected to reach $5.4 billion by 2030, according to recent industry analysis. This represents a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 6.1% over the forecast period, reflecting strong demand across both commercial and residential sectors.

Zero-turn mowers, known for their superior maneuverability and time-saving capabilities, have firmly established themselves as the preferred choice for professional landscapers and are increasingly gaining traction among residential consumers with larger properties. The ability to pivot 180 degrees with zero turning radius continues to be the defining feature driving market expansion.
Market Segment Analysis
The commercial segment currently dominates the zero-turn mower market, accounting for approximately 65% of total revenue. Landscape contractors, municipal groundskeepers, and sports facility managers remain the primary purchasers, valuing the productivity gains and reduced labor costs these machines provide. The residential segment, while smaller at 35% market share, is growing at a faster pace as homeowners with larger properties increasingly recognize the time-saving benefits and improved cutting quality.
In terms of cutting width, mid-size mowers (48-54 inches) represent the largest segment at 42% market share, offering an optimal balance of coverage area and maneuverability. The large cutting width segment (55+ inches) follows at 30%, primarily serving commercial applications, while smaller cutting widths (less than 48 inches) comprise the remaining 28%, popular among residential users with space constraints.
The gasoline-powered segment continues to dominate with 78% market share, though this is gradually declining as electric and battery-powered alternatives gain momentum, currently representing 22% of the market and growing at twice the rate of traditional fuel options.
Market Growth Analysis
The transition toward sustainable landscaping practices is significantly influencing market dynamics, with battery-powered zero-turn mowers experiencing the fastest growth at 15.2% CAGR. Environmental regulations targeting emissions and noise pollution in urban areas are accelerating this shift, particularly in the commercial segment where operating hours may be restricted.
North America remains the largest market, representing 48% of global sales, followed by Europe at 27% and Asia-Pacific at 18%. However, the Asia-Pacific region is experiencing the most rapid growth at 8.7% CAGR, driven by increasing urbanization, rising disposable incomes, and growth in commercial landscaping services.
Market Trends
Several key trends are reshaping the zero-turn mower landscape. Technological integration is at the forefront, with manufacturers incorporating GPS navigation, automated route planning, and mobile app connectivity. These smart features optimize cutting patterns, reduce operator fatigue, and provide detailed performance analytics.
Sustainability concerns are driving significant R&D investment in alternative power sources. Battery technology improvements have addressed previous limitations in runtime and power, making electric zero-turn mowers increasingly viable for professional applications. Hydrogen fuel cell prototypes are also emerging, promising extended operation without lengthy recharge times.
Comfort features are becoming standard as manufacturers compete for market share, with enhanced suspension systems, ergonomic controls, and improved weather protection addressing operator needs for all-day use. Additionally, modular design approaches are gaining popularity, allowing for seasonal attachment changes that transform mowers into multi-function machines.
Competitive Analysis
The market remains moderately consolidated, with the top five manufacturers controlling approximately 62% of global sales. Deere & Company (John Deere) maintains market leadership with a 24% share, followed by Husqvarna Group (18%), The Toro Company (11%), Ariens Company (5%), and Kubota Corporation (4%). However, competitive intensity is increasing as mid-sized manufacturers introduce innovative features and aggressive pricing strategies to capture market share.
Chinese manufacturers are also gaining ground in the value segment, leveraging cost advantages to penetrate price-sensitive markets, particularly in developing regions. This has prompted established players to introduce tiered product lines addressing various price points while maintaining brand differentiation through quality and warranty offerings.
Market Opportunities and Research Insight
Significant market opportunities exist in the rapidly growing autonomous mower segment, currently in its nascent stage but expected to revolutionize the industry within the next decade. Commercial property managers seeking to address labor shortages and reduce operational costs represent the early adoption target for these solutions.
The rental market presents another untapped opportunity, particularly for high-end commercial models that may be cost-prohibitive for smaller landscaping operations or occasional residential users. Subscription-based ownership models are emerging, combining equipment access with maintenance packages that appeal to budget-conscious buyers.
As sustainability priorities continue to shape purchasing decisions, manufacturers that successfully balance environmental considerations with performance capabilities will likely capture growing market share. Research indicates that over 40% of prospective buyers now consider environmental impact a significant decision factor, up from just 18% five years ago.
